Deborah Betts Moore-Roberson, MSSA, Recognized by Cambridge Who's Who
Deborah Betts Moore-Roberson specializes in giving hope and encouragement to persons most in need

AKRON, OH, August 8, 2011 /24-7PressRelease/ -- Deborah Betts Moore-Roberson, MSSA, Supervisor of the Assertive Community Treatment Team at Community Support Services Inc., has been recognized by Cambridge Who's Who for demonstrating dedication, leadership and excellence in social work.

Ms. Betts Moore-Roberson has 15 years of professional experience, but considers herself to have always been a social worker at heart because of her desire to help others and offer her assistance in any situation possible. For the past six years, she has served as supervisor of the assertive community treatment team at Community Support Services, Inc. The agency aims to enhance quality of life, primarily for persons most in need, by offering first-rate and cost-effective treatment, rehabilitation, advocacy and recovery support. In her position, Ms. Betts Moore-Roberson specializes in giving hope and encouragement to others. She provides staff support, works with treatment teams, oversees crisis interventions and conducts psychotherapy sessions.

A licensed social worker, Ms. Betts Moore-Roberson holds a Master of Science in social services administration from Case Western Reserve University. In 1995, she earned a Bachelor of Science in social work from the University of Akron. In addition to her work with Community Support Services, Inc., she is an associate minister at her local United Baptist Church and a supporter of The Mama Pilista Bonyo Memorial Health Center in Kenya. Ms. Betts Moore-Roberson hopes to continue to work with other concerned people to assist the village of Masara, Kenya and surrounding areas. She also plans to collaborate with her church to establish group homes for veterans and other people in need.
